New Zealand - Import of Non-Coniferous Hoopwood, Split Poles, Pile, Pickets and Stakes

Since 2014, New Zealand Import of Non-Coniferous Hoopwood, Split Poles, Pile, Pickets and Stakes rose 17.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 27 comparing other countries in Import of Non-Coniferous Hoopwood, Split Poles, Pile, Pickets and Stakes at $515,354.2. New Zealand is overtaken by Saudi Arabia, which was ranked number 26 with $613,181.24 and is followed by Mozambique with $482,832.43. Netherlands ranked the highest with $12,681,039.36 in 2019, that is -0.8% compared to 2018. France, Poland and Indonesia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Estonia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+233.3% per year, while Tanzania witnessed the worst performance at -90.6% per year.
